Python实现猜数字游戏算法详细解析如何编写?
- 内容介绍
- 文章标签
- 相关推荐
本文共计977个文字,预计阅读时间需要4分钟。
今天刷的第一道算法题,先拿一道简单的试手,这道题目的要求是:两人猜数字,甲先从1、2、3三个数字中随机抽3次,结果是guess。乙随后也随机抽3次,结果是answer。
今天刷的第一道算法题,先拿一道简单点的试试手,这道题目的要求是:
两个人甲乙在猜数字,甲先从1,2,3三个数字中随机抽3次,结果是guess。乙随后也随机抽三次,结果是answer。然后对比甲乙两个人的结果。示例如下:
guess:[1,2,3], answer: [1, 2, 3]
那么结果就是猜对了3次
guess: [1,2,3] answer:[3,2,1]
那么结果就是猜对了1次
guess: [1,2,3], answer:[3, 3,1]
那么结果就是猜对了0次
即将guess和answer两个作为参数输入,返回猜对的次数。
本文共计977个文字,预计阅读时间需要4分钟。
今天刷的第一道算法题,先拿一道简单的试手,这道题目的要求是:两人猜数字,甲先从1、2、3三个数字中随机抽3次,结果是guess。乙随后也随机抽3次,结果是answer。
今天刷的第一道算法题,先拿一道简单点的试试手,这道题目的要求是:
两个人甲乙在猜数字,甲先从1,2,3三个数字中随机抽3次,结果是guess。乙随后也随机抽三次,结果是answer。然后对比甲乙两个人的结果。示例如下:
guess:[1,2,3], answer: [1, 2, 3]
那么结果就是猜对了3次
guess: [1,2,3] answer:[3,2,1]
那么结果就是猜对了1次
guess: [1,2,3], answer:[3, 3,1]
那么结果就是猜对了0次
即将guess和answer两个作为参数输入,返回猜对的次数。

